Vote for the next mayor or mayoress of Neustadt an der Weinstraße today! Let's meet the candidates, incumbent Marc Weigel (FWG) and the independent Steffi Karbach.

Both candidates have roots in Neustadt and are passionate about their city. However, they come from different backgrounds: Marc Weigel hails from the Free Voters, while Steffi Karbach is a self-employed digital strategies consultant with no political experience. With distinct agendas, let's see what they have in store for Neustadt.

Karbach: Independent Vision for Neustadt

Steffi Karbach emphasizes a future-oriented, fair, and democratic Neustadt where everyone feels welcome, regardless of origin, income, or lifestyle. Karbach aims to create a culture of open dialogue, support eco-friendly urban development, foster small businesses, and bolster local economy.

Karbach highlights the challenges of affordable housing, the effects of climate change, and the need for democratic renewal as her main concerns for Neustadt.

Weigel: Building on Neustadt's Success

Weigel hopes to further develop and preserve Neustadt's high quality of life and stay, with the Landesgartenschau 2027, fire and disaster protection structures renovation, and reducing public infrastructure backlog as his main goals.

Weigel acknowledges economic competition, climate change, and financial constraints as the city's main challenges.

Campaign Differences

The incumbent Weigel has put up around 150 election posters in the city, compared to none from Steffi Karbach, who lacks the necessary funds as an independent candidate. But despite different starting points, their dedication to Neustadt remains unwavering.

Around 42,000 eligible voters will cast their ballots today to decide who will lead Neustadt an der Weinstraße. Regardless of the outcome, Karbach believes her campaign has already made an essential contribution to democracy by encouraging dialogues and choice within the city.
